[D8850ABW], Letter from Hannah (Mrs Joseph W.) Swan to Thomas Alva Edison, July 12th, 1888
Editor's Notes
"Thank you for your reply to my letter I was very sorry not to have one of your phonographs in time for Mr. Larius Scientific gathering, + I write to say that I hope I may have the pleasure of receiving one before October as I should like to give Mr. Larius one for a birthday present. If one of the phonographs sent with the instrument even a message from you to my husban, I am sure it would give him great pleasure to hear your voice. ### By this mail I am sending you a portrait of Mr. Swan taken by a photo-engraving process which is worked by one of our [unclear]. ### We should like to know when we may have the pleasure of seeing you + Mrs. Edison here, + with our congratulations on the birth of your little daughter, believe me." ["No ans."]
